Most chapters in this guide consist of a checklist at the beginning of the chapter listing the tasks and commands for monitoring a Juniper Networks routing platform in an MPLS network environment. The tasks and commands are then explained in step-by-step procedures.
Each step-by-step procedure consists of some or all of the following parts:
- Purpose—Describes what is affected if this task is not performed or what is accomplished with this task.
- Steps To Take—Lists the steps in the task.
- Action—Describes an action or actions to perform in order to complete the step.
- Sample Output—Presents sample output relevant to the procedure.
- What It Means—Describes or summarizes what is presented in the sample output.
- Symptom—Describes a problem with the software or hardware.
- Cause—Describes the reason that the problem occurred.
- Troubleshooting Commands—Presents JUNOS software commands useful when troubleshooting the problem.
- Solution—Describes a method for solving the problem.
- Conclusion—Describes the final outcome of the process.
